The Fjordland Paradise route takes you through some of the most breathtaking scenery in Nord-Norge. With a total distance of 159 km and an ascent of 2208 meters, it offers a challenging but rewarding experience for cyclists. As you ride along the route, you'll be treated to majestic fjords, picturesque villages, and panoramic views of the surrounding mountains. The mix of coastal and mountain landscapes make this route truly unique and unforgettable.

SjøveganVillage
Sjøvegan is a charming village nestled along the fjord with a rich cultural heritage. Take a break here to explore the local museums and enjoy some delicious seafood.
SkøelvaVillage
Skøelva waterfall is a stunning natural wonder along the route. Marvel at the power and beauty of the cascading water as you pass by.
ReisvatnetLake
Reisvatnet is a crystal-clear lake surrounded by majestic mountains. Stop here to take in the serene beauty of this scenic spot.
HeggeliaSub-urb
Heggelia is a quaint village with traditional Norwegian architecture. Take a stroll through the charming streets and stop by a local cafe for a traditional Norwegian treat.
